Rails və ya Rails-daRuby, Ruby-də MİT Lisenziyası altında yazılmış bir server tərəfi web proqramıdır. Rails bir verilənlər bazası, veb xidməti və veb səhifələr üçün standart strukturları təmin edən bir model görünüşü nəzarətçi (MVC) çərçivəsidir. Bu məlumat ötürülməsi üçün JSON və ya XML kimi web standartlarının istifadəsini və görünüş və istifadəçi interfeysi üçün HTML, CSS və JavaScript-ni asanlaşdırır. MVC-yə əlavə olaraq, Rails digər tanınmış proqram mühəndisliyi nümunələri və paradiqmaların, konfiqurasiya (CoC) üzərində konfiqurasiya, özünüzü təkrar etməyin (DRY) və aktiv qeyd desenini istifadə etməyi vurğulayır.
►Bu tətbiq, verilənlər bazasında dəstəklənən web applications inkişaf etdirmək üçün Ruby çərçivəsini istifadə etmək istəyən başlayanlar üçün nəzərdə tutulmuşdur
【Bu tətbiqdə əhatə olunan mövzular aşağıda qeyd olunur】
⇢ Ruby on Rails - Baxış
⇢ Giriş
⇢ Quraşdırma
⇢ Çərçivə
⇢ Directory Strukturu
⇢ Nümunələr
⇢ Database Setup
⇢ Active Records
⇢ Migrasiya
⇢ Controller
⇢ Routes
⇢ Views
⇢ Layouts
⇢ İskele
⇢ AJAX
⇢ Fayl yükləməsi
⇢ E-poçt göndər
⇢ Rails haqqında Ruby nədir?
⇢ Niyə Ruby?
⇢ Ruby'yi Rayları öyrənmək üçün öyrənməlisiniz?
⇢ Niyə Rails?
Rail Rails Rəhbər Prinsipləri Anlayın
Rails çətinləşir harada
⇢ Rails necə işləyir
A Rails tətbiqi üzrə altı perspektiv
⇢ Rails Stack
Yeni başlayanlar üçün yaxşı yollar var?
Other Ruby və Rails digər proqramlaşdırma dillərindən və veb çərçivələrindən nə fərqlənir?
Rail Rails'də Ruby'yi öyrənmək üçün bəzi yollar nədir və bunu nə qədər gözləməyiniz lazımdır?
⇢ Rails Doktrina
Program Proqramçı xoşbəxtliyini optimallaşdırın
Konfiqurasiya üzrə Konvensiya
⇢ Menyu omakase edir
⇢ Heç bir paradiqma
⇢ Gözəl kodu cəlb edin
⇢ kəskin bıçaqla təmin edin
⇢ Dəyərli inteqrasiya sistemləri
Stability İstikrarla bağlı irəliləyiş
A Böyük bir çadırı itələyin
⇢ Guide Varsayımlar
⇢ Yeni Rails Layihəsi yaradılması
⇢ Veb Serverin başlanması
⇢ Getting və Running
The Torpaq işlərini yerə qoymaq
⇢ Məqalələr yaratmaq
A Miqrasiya etmə
⇢ Model yaratmaq
⇢ Birləşən Modellər
⇢ Refactoring
⇢ Şərhlərin silinməsi
⇢ Təhlükəsizlik Əsas Doğrulama
⇢ Konfiqurasiya Gotches
⇢ Səhv hesabat yaradılması
Feature Bədii İstekler haqqında nədir?
Your Kodunuzu müqayisə et
⇢ dəyişiklikləri yeniləyir
⇢ Çəngəl
Rail Rails-də Ruby-nin köhnə versiyaları
Active Active Record nədir
Aktiv qeyddə Konfiqurasiya Konvensiyası
N Adlandırma Konvensiyalarının ləğvi
⇢ CRUD: Data oxumaq və yazmaq
⇢ Validasiyalar
Güncəlləmə vaxtı
9 apr 2020